Ribosomes at first: observed in 1950

by Romanian cell biologist “George

Emil Palade” using an electron

microscope.

Prokaryotic Ribosomes Eukaryotic Ribosomes

• Prokaryotic ribosomes arearound 20 nm (200 Å) indiameter and are composedof 65% rRNA and 35%ribosomal proteins.

Eukaryotic ribosomes arebetween 25 and 30 nm(250– 300 Å) in diameterwith an rRNA to proteinratio that is close to 1.

Also Found in Mitochondria.
